Answer:
y = 2x - 1
Step-by-step explanation:
The given line is y = 2x - 6.
It is in the y = mx + b form, where m is the slope, so its slope is 2.
We need a line that passes through point P(3, 5) and has slope 2.
y = mx + b
Put the slope in m.
y = 2x + b
Use the given point with x = 3 and y = 5 and solve for b.
5 = 2(3) + b
b + 6 = 5
b = -1
The equation is
y = 2x - 1
